October 19,2022 I was driving (cruise control about 70 mph) and hit a deer. The impact and damage was quite a bit however no airbags deployed. The car is still being repaired at Blakely Chevrolet in Blakely GA and they are having issues with airbag sensors.

At what mileage does the airbags typically fail?
Across the 10 complaints that reported odometer mileage, most airbags failures cluster between 46,000 and 70,000 miles, with the median around 62,000. A quarter of owners report trouble before 46,000; a quarter make it past 70,000. Maintenance history matters more than the odometer alone — this is the reported failure window, not a guarantee.
